Output 664c328c2d98c3e203ceffd6189f13b2ab50c16c888e60e0847a44b4d2343973:0

value
8089879
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b2a3d9c23868938b00f21fc12484c6a056cc1e53 OP_EQUALVERIFY OP_CHECKSIG
address
1HHZZgpGNATguQdVxpCT2Ni6BzWQAsRqSV
transaction
664c328c2d98c3e203ceffd6189f13b2ab50c16c888e60e0847a44b4d2343973
spent
true